## Service account: addrsuggest-prod

The Wrenfield address autocomplete widget calls the internal Placewright lookup service through the `addrsuggest-prod` account. Before cutting a release, confirm the account's quota allocation matches projected traffic — the widget fires a lookup on every third keystroke, so estimates run high. Rotation happens on the first Monday of each quarter; releases scheduled within 48 hours of rotation should be postponed. The current key for the account appears below.

service key, fawip-bajef: kto11_Qt5wZK9vdNC

Subject: Quickstore 4.2 — bloom filter now fronts the KV layer

Plugin authors: starting with this release, Quickstore places a bloom filter ahead of the key-value store. Negative lookups return faster; false positives fall through safely. No API changes are required on your side. Verify your plugin against the staging build referenced below.

session token of fahif-tadup = htk3_9c7

## Parcelwing Webhook: Stuck Deliveries

If Parcelwing stops emitting scan events, first check the retry queue depth — anything over 2k means the downstream consumer is choking. Restart the relay worker, then replay from the last checkpoint. Don't panic, this happens most Mondays. Full step-by-step instructions with screenshots live on the internal page.

runbook for tajep-yahig: https://artifactory.lumictech.corp/repo